About The Ingredients To Make Cranberry Slush Punch?

This punch recipe is simple, only requiring a few ingredients. All of the ingredients are easily found at your local store.

Christmas Punch Recipe (2)
  1. Cranberry juice- I like to use 100% cranberry juice instead of co*cktail or mixed fruit. We will be adding other sweeteners so a nice tart cranberry juice is perfect.
  2. Orange Juice- Your favorite brand is perfect.
  3. 100% Pineapple Juice. I'm a fan of Dole Pineapple juice. They have great quality.
  4. Sugar- Sugar is important for creating the slush!
  5. 2-3 2 liters of lemon lime soda or ginger ale. Feel free to opt for a sugar free soda since the juices all have natural sugars.

How Do I Make This Christmas Punch Recipe?

You will want to plan to make this recipe 1 day before your party. You can make it a few days before too! This first step needs to freeze overnight, so plan accordingly.

Christmas Punch Recipe (3)
  1. In a large, freezer-safe bowl add 1.5 Cups of sugar.
  2. Pour in cranberry juice.
  3. Pour in Dole pineapple juice
  4. Add orange juice.
Christmas Punch Recipe (4)
  1. Stir to combine
  2. Freeze for 12-18 hours. Remove from freezer and let stand for 1 hour.
  3. Using a study fork, break apart into a granita consistency.
  4. Add to your punch bowl.
Christmas Punch Recipe (5)

Combine Soda with Slush

I like to add about ⅓-1/2 of the slush mixture to my punch bowl with the 1 of the soda's. As the party is slowly drinking the punch refill as needed.

If Your punch bowl is large enough you can use the entire recipe at once.

Can I use a drink dispenser?

Because this drink is a slush drink dispensers do not work well. Punch bowls are perfect with a large ladle.

What Size Punch Bowl do I need?

You can purchase large inexpensive punch bowls at party centers or super centers. I have a large glass bowl I use and it works great! I just need to refill it a little more often.

Do I have to use sugar?

The juices and soda already have sugar why use more? The sugar is what allows the juices to turn into a slush rather than an ice cube.

Christmas Punch Recipe (9)

Pro Party Tips:

Make this ahead. Once frozen I like to chop it up into the granita and place it in an air tight bag bag or container. Then its ready to be used anytime over the next 3 months! just keep frozen.

If you live in a place where you have cold weather place the soda outside instead of taking up precious fridge space

If traveling with the punch keep the soda separate from the slush. Mix at party.

Put the fruit juice granita in a plastic container or bag on ice in a cooler until you arrive at destination. You do NOT want that melting.

Ingredients

  • 48 ounces pineapple juice
  • 48 ounces cranberry juice
  • 48 ounces orange juice
  • 1 ½ cups sugar
  • fresh raspberries for garnish
  • rosemary sprigs for garnish
  • fresh cranberries for garnish
  • 2-3 2 liter lemon lime soda can use ginger ale or sugar free

Instructions

  • Mix 3 juices in a large bowl. Stir in sugar until dissolved.

  • Poor into freezer safe container and freeze for 12-48 hours. Or overnight.

  • Let stand on the counter one hour before serving.

  • Using a sturdy fork or knife, chop mixture into large chunks.

  • Place pieces in goblet or punch bowl, pour sprite over and garnish as desired.
